One Injured in Manhole Explosion
2nd Ave & E 36th St, Tudor City, Manhattan

Timeline
Firefighters report the situation is under control.
Firefighters continue to operate on the scene.
Con Edison personnel are on scene.
Firefighters report they are blocking off 2nd Ave from E 36th St to E 37th St.
Firefighters report multiple construction plates are smoking.
Firefighters are requesting police for traffic control.
Firefighters report there is one known injury associated with the explosion.
Con Edison personnel are being requested to the scene.
Firefighters confirm a manhole explosion at this location.
Police have received a report of a manhole explosion; this is unconfirmed.
Incident reported at 2nd Ave & E 36th St.
